Period: 1900 BCE to 1600 BCE
Babylonian Tablets
These tablets indicate some knowledge of the theorem, detailed calculation of the square root of 2, and lists of integers known as the Pythagorean triples. -
Period: 800 BCE to 400 BCE
Baudhayana Sulba-sutra of India
The theorem was mentioned in the Baudhayana Sulba-sutra of India and was started before Pythagora's lifetime. -
